Buying an aftermarket seat belt for your Hyundai Palisade 2020-2025, specifically model number 88810-S8000WDN, comes with both advantages and disadvantages. Here's a brief analysis of each:
Advantages:1. Cost-effective: Aftermarket seat belts are typically less expensive than original equipment manufacturer (OEM) belts. Installing an aftermarket belt could save you a significant amount of money, especially if you need multiple belts.
2. Availability: Aftermarket parts are often more readily available than OEM parts, particularly for less common models or when dealing with long lead times from dealerships.
3. Customizability: Aftermarket seat belts may offer additional features such as adjustable lengths, different colors, or more comfortable padding for enhanced user experience.
Disadvantages:1. Quality concerns: Aftermarket parts may not always meet the same standards as OEM parts. The 88810-S8000WDN seat belt, for example, might not provide the same level of safety or durability as a genuine Hyundai part.
2. Installation: Installing aftermarket seat belts can sometimes be more complicated than OEM belts due to differences in connector shapes or materials. Misaligning or incorrectly installing the belt could compromise its effectiveness.
3. Warranty: OEM seat belts usually come with a manufacturer warranty, while aftermarket parts may not have the same level of coverage or may have more limited warranties.
